实用网状粒子Canvas特效代码,支持二次修改
版权申诉
118 浏览量
更新于2024-10-19
收藏 36KB ZIP 举报
资源摘要信息:"透明的网状粒子Canvas特效"
在现代网页设计中,特效的应用是提升用户视觉体验的重要手段之一。此次提供的“透明的网状粒子Canvas特效”是一种基于Canvas的Web特效代码,它能够为网页带来吸引眼球的动态视觉效果。该特效使用了JavaScript库jQuery以及CSS技术,创造出一种由透明粒子构成的网状动态背景。
### 知识点一:Canvas技术
Canvas是一种基于HTML5的技术,它允许开发者在网页上绘制图形和动画。Canvas元素提供了一块画布,开发者可以使用JavaScript的API在上面绘制形状、文字、图像以及其他任何你能想象到的东西。Canvas技术非常适合用于创建动态的网页内容和游戏,因为它提供了非常丰富的图形操作能力。
### 知识点二:jQuery特效
jQuery是一个快速、小巧且功能丰富的JavaScript库。它简化了HTML文档遍历、事件处理、动画和Ajax交互等任务。在Web开发中,jQuery被广泛用于简化JavaScript编程,提高开发效率。使用jQuery制作特效通常意味着代码更简洁、易于维护,并且能够兼容多数浏览器。
### 知识点三:CSS特效
CSS(层叠样式表)用于控制网页的布局、颜色、字体和其他视觉元素。CSS特效则是在此基础上,通过CSS3提供的新属性,如动画(`@keyframes`)、过渡(`transition`)、变换(`transform`)等,为网页元素添加动态变化效果。CSS特效不仅能够提高用户界面的吸引力,而且相比于传统的JavaScript实现,它们通常具有更好的性能和更少的资源消耗。
### 知识点四:网状粒子动态特效
网状粒子特效是一种视觉效果,通常表现为无数小粒子在屏幕上动态排列成网状结构,并随时间流动改变其位置、大小、透明度等属性。这类特效可以通过Canvas实现粒子的绘制,并通过JavaScript控制粒子运动的逻辑。透明的网状粒子特效则是在此基础上增加了透明度变化,使得粒子动态效果更加柔和且具有层次感。
### 知识点五:二次修改与定制
提供“透明的网状粒子Canvas特效”的代码包允许开发者进行二次修改和定制。这意味着开发者可以根据自己的需求,调整特效的表现形式和行为。比如改变粒子的形状、颜色、运动规律,或者将特效应用于特定的网页元素上。这种灵活性是开源代码和现代Web开发工具链的一个显著优势。
### 知识点六:压缩包子文件的文件结构
文件名称“jiaoben7021”可能指的是压缩文件的名称。一般情况下,开发者会将相关的HTML、CSS、JavaScript文件以及图像资源等放入一个压缩包中,便于上传和下载。在解压缩之后,用户可以看到包含特效实现的完整代码结构,包括HTML模板、样式表、脚本文件等。这些文件的组织结构直接影响到特效的可维护性和可扩展性。
综上所述,“透明的网状粒子Canvas特效”不仅是一个即插即用的视觉组件,而且为开发者提供了一个动手实践和创造个性化网页特效的起点。通过了解和学习上述知识点,开发者可以更好地掌握如何将这类特效应用到自己的项目中,提升网站的视觉吸引力和用户体验。
2023-10-10 上传
2023-10-15 上传
2023-10-08 上传
2023-09-26 上传
2023-10-10 上传
2023-10-15 上传
2023-10-08 上传
2023-10-09 上传
2023-10-10 上传
码云笔记
- 粉丝: 3w+
- 资源: 5851
最新资源
- 探索数据转换实验平台在设备装置中的应用
- 使用git-log-to-tikz.py将Git日志转换为TIKZ图形
- 小栗子源码2.9.3版本发布
- 使用Tinder-Hack-Client实现Tinder API交互
- Android Studio新模板:个性化Material Design导航抽屉
- React API分页模块:数据获取与页面管理
- C语言实现顺序表的动态分配方法
- 光催化分解水产氢固溶体催化剂制备技术揭秘
- VS2013环境下tinyxml库的32位与64位编译指南
- 网易云歌词情感分析系统实现与架构
- React应用展示GitHub用户详细信息及项目分析
- LayUI2.1.6帮助文档API功能详解
- 全栈开发实现的chatgpt应用可打包小程序/H5/App
- C++实现顺序表的动态内存分配技术
- Java制作水果格斗游戏:策略与随机性的结合
- 基于若依框架的后台管理系统开发实例解析